Overlooking to Include Trick Information



When planning a funeral program, it's essential not to forget crucial info, as doing so can lead to confusion for participants.



Make certain you consist of the complete name of the dead, the day of birth, and the date of passing. Plainly list the solution details, consisting of the date, time, and area, so everyone knows where to go.

It's likewise crucial to mention any kind of special requests, such as gown codes or philanthropic donations. Don't forget to consist of a quick outline of the service's routine, highlighting speakers or efficiencies.

Lastly, think about adding get in touch with info for the family members or funeral chapel in case participants have inquiries. By consisting of all appropriate details, you'll help produce a considerate and orderly experience for everyone involved.

Selecting an Inappropriate Layout



While it may appear alluring to select a design that reflects personal preferences, going with an inappropriate design for a funeral program can interfere with the sad nature of the occasion.

You intend to ensure that the style honors the deceased and conveys the appropriate tone. Bright colors, whimsical graphics, or overly laid-back typefaces can come off as ill-mannered.

Instead, lean in the direction of even more subdued shades and sophisticated designs that match the ambience of mourning. Think about including elements that mirror the person's life, like refined signs or themes that reverberate with their personality.

Ultimately, your goal is to create a respectful and significant tribute, so pick a layout that straightens with the gravity of the occasion and supplies convenience to attendees.

Overwhelming With Text



Overloading a funeral program with message can bewilder attendees and sidetrack from the intended message. You wish to honor your loved one while supplying essential information, however way too much message can make it hard for individuals to absorb what's important.

Aim for brevity; usage clear, concise language to communicate key details like the service timetable, area, and any kind of special tributes.

Think about separating message with headings or bullet indicate assist overview readers with the program. Include purposeful quotes or poems, but keep them short and impactful.

Failing to Proofread



One crucial error people make in funeral programs is falling short to check. Neglecting typos and grammatical errors can result in misconceptions and even harmed feelings during a sensitive time.

When you're focused on developing a purposeful homage, it's simple to miss small errors that can diminish the general message. Make the effort to read through the program multiple times, and think about asking a trusted friend or relative to assess it also. Fresh eyes can capture errors you may ignore.

Utilizing Low-Quality Photos



While it could be appealing to make use of any kind of available image for a funeral program, opting for low-grade photos can interfere with the general tribute. Fuzzy or pixelated photos don't recognize your enjoyed one; rather, they may make the program feel hurried or unconsidered.

Aim for high-resolution photos that plainly capture their personality and spirit. If you don't have many alternatives, take into consideration asking family or friends for much better images. It's vital to choose photos that stimulate fond memories and reflect the essence of the person being kept in mind.
